DARKNESS AND LIGHT
DARKNESS AND LIGHT I sit in the sunshine that’s today But shadows stretch out behind me … Why is it that we can’t escape the darkness; Gray-dark nights that hunt our blue-light days, Nights that lurk within And hide behind the sunshine of our smiles? What will it take to shine the sun into the corners that hide the half-seen predators that shun the light and feed on fear? Nothing. The light is only a one-way window, The dark inside is me.
